Ok, it really doesn’t have anything to do with concrete (rebar). It actually doesn’t have anything to do with drinking, either (bar camp). Instead, it is about peer-to-peer technology education. Blogging, social networking, video, listing search technologies and better utilization of market data were some of the covered subjects.

590 Baltimore Ave, Lilburn, GA 30047 is being offered at $400,000.  And it is an exceptional property.  Four bedrooms, three and a half bath, and two 2 car garages.  There is a full finished basement.

This is a really cool place, and there isn’t anything else like it.  From the long winding driveway through the three acres to the house surrounded by woods and the creek, the house transports you to another place.

Georgia Housing Tax Credit Bill

Today, House Bill 261 was signed by Governor Sonny Perdue. This bill provides an $1800 tax credit which would be taken over three years. This bill is immediately in effect and is meant to spur the housing market. The amount of the credit will either be $1800 or 1.2 percent of the purchase price (whichever is less).

If you are a first time home buyer, this tax credit would be in addition to the $8000 federal credit. Eligible properties include single family residences including condos, previously occupied homes that were listed for sale before May 11, 2009 and are still listed, and bank owned properties. The bill did not include investment properties.

The goal of this bill is obviously to provide an incentive to move current inventory and to get would be home buyers back in the game.
